  1. Level the vehicle.
  2. Complete the "BEFORE SERVICE PRECAUTION". (See BEFORE SERVICE PRECAUTION .)
  3. Disconnect the negative battery terminal. (See NEGATIVE BATTERY TERMINAL DISCONNECTION/CONNECTION .)
  4. Drain the fuel. (See FUEL DRAINING PROCEDURE .)
  5. Remove the rear seat cushion. (See REAR SEAT CUSHION RE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
  6. Remove the service hole cover. (2WD)
    G13672460Courtesy of MAZDA MOTORS CORP.
  7. Remove the service hole cover. (AWD)
    G13672461Courtesy of MAZDA MOTORS CORP.
  8. Disconnect the following parts. (2WD)
  9. Disconnect the following parts. (AWD)

    Main side 

  10. Remove the floor under cover. (See FLOOR UNDER COVER RE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
  11. Disconnect the HO2S connector. (See HEATED OXYGEN SENSOR (HO2S) RE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
  12. Remove the HO2S clip from the body. (See HEATED OXYGEN SENSOR (HO2S) RE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
  13. Remove the TWC and HO2S as a single unit. (See EXHAUST SYSTEM RE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
  14. Remove the propeller shaft. (AWD) (See PROPELLER SHAFT RE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
  15. Remove in the order indicated in the table.
  16. Install in the reverse order of removal.
  17. Complete the "AFTER SERVICE PRECAUTION". (See AFTER SERVICE PRECAUTION .)
